VoIP Services: A Modern Solution
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) services have revolutionized the way we communicate. If you’re looking to call Ireland from the US, opting for a VoIP service can be a game-changer in terms of cost-effectiveness. Providers like Skype, Google Voice, and WhatsApp allow you to make calls over the internet, often at little to no cost.
Here’s a brief overview of popular VoIP services:
- Skype: Offers affordable rates for calls to landlines in Ireland. You can also call other Skype users for free.
- Google Voice: Provides low rates for international calls and is easy to use with your existing phone number.
- WhatsApp: Allows free voice and video calls over Wi-Fi, making it a great option for staying connected with friends and family in Ireland.
Understanding Ireland Phone Codes
When dialing Ireland from the US, it’s crucial to understand the country and area codes. The country code for Ireland is +353. Here’s how to structure your call:
- Dial 011 (the exit code for the US).
- Then dial 353 (the country code for Ireland).
- Follow it with the area code and the local number.
For example, if you wanted to call Dublin, you’d dial: 011-353-1-XXXX-XXXX.
Communication Costs: What to Expect
The overall cost of calling Ireland from the US can vary widely depending on the method you choose. Here’s a breakdown of potential costs:
- Landline to Landline: Typically ranges from $0.15 to $0.50 per minute.
- Mobile to Mobile: Costs can be higher, often between $0.30 to $1.00 per minute.
- VoIP Services: Usually charge a fraction of traditional rates, often less than $0.05 per minute.

4. How do I dial a mobile number in Ireland from the US?
Dial 011 (exit code) + 353 (country code) + the mobile number (dropping the leading 0).
